ABS CF (Acrylonitrile Butadiene Styrene with Carbon Fiber) reinforced composites integrate the advantages of ABS plastic and the strength and rigidity of carbon fiber, creating a material with improved mechanical attributes and durability. ABS CF reinforced composites present a persuasive combination of enhanced mechanical properties and flexibility, making them suitable for a wide array of challenging applications across diverse industries. With technological progress, their usage is likely to increase further, driven by the demand for lightweight, strong, and durable materials in modern manufacturing.
Main features: 1. Incorporating carbon fiber boosts ABS's strength and rigidity, ideal for firmness-demanding applications. 2. Remains lightweight compared to metals, beneficial for weight reduction. 3. Enhances dimensional stability, minimizing distortion for precise manufacturing. 4. Shows better heat resistance than standard ABS. 5. Has a smoother and more appealing surface finish. Applications: Used in automotive, aerospace, consumer goods, industrial equipment, and prototyping/tooling for its properties.

How does the price of ABS CF Reinforced Composites compare to traditional materials?
The price of ABS CF Reinforced Composites is usually slightly higher than that of traditional materials because of its superior performance and the inclusion of reinforcing components such as carbon fiber. However, the specific price is affected by factors such as market supply and demand and production scale.
What level of strength can this material reach?
The strength of this material is significantly higher than that of ordinary ABS materials. The specific strength level depends on factors such as the content and distribution of carbon fiber and can generally meet the needs of various high-strength applications.
How is the corrosion resistance of ABS CF Reinforced Composites?
ABS CF Reinforced Composites have good corrosion resistance and can resist the erosion of various chemicals. However, the specific degree of corrosion resistance is also affected by factors such as the type and concentration of chemicals.
How does its performance behave in high-temperature environments?
It can still maintain good mechanical properties and dimensional stability in high-temperature environments. Compared to ordinary ABS materials, its high-temperature resistance performance has improved significantly.
How to process ABS CF Reinforced Composites?
Common processing methods include injection molding, extrusion molding, etc. During processing, adjustments need to be made according to specific process requirements and equipment conditions.
How to distinguish the quality of ABS CF Reinforced Composites?
To distinguish the quality, it can be judged from aspects such as the uniformity of the appearance, strength tests of the material, and checking relevant quality certifications.
How long is the service life of ABS CF Reinforced Composites approximately?
Its service life depends on factors such as the usage environment and load conditions. Under normal usage and maintenance conditions, it usually has a long service life.
Compared to other reinforced composites, what are its unique advantages?
Compared to other reinforced composites, it combines the good processing performance of ABS and the advantages of high strength and high rigidity brought by carbon fiber, and the cost is also relatively reasonable.
